

Born in Providence, he was the son of the late Filomena (Pontarelli) and Ernest Angelo.
He was the beloved husband of 57 years to Mary (Celona) Angelo; loving father to Alisa Sanderson (Scott) and Anita Hoag (Michael); and the adoring grandfather to Alec, Kayla, and Kyle Sanderson, and Andrew and Katharine Hoag.
David served in the United States Army and later owned and operated a textile mill for many years.
He was an active member of the Italo American Club, Sons of Italy, the Italian American Historical Society of Rhode Island, the Holy Name Society, and the Kirkbrae Country Club. He was an avid Boston Red Sox fan and was an honorary black belt.
